Company activities and impact

Hurtwood Events executed the 2nd Hurtwood Enduro mountain bike race at Coverwood Farm. The event was supported by local business and the general community. It has improved the visibility of sustainable mountain biking event, and has bought the local community and the mountain biking community closer together. The event generated revenue to local catering businesses, the local farm, as well as some locals who worked organising the event. Hurtwood Events has now also taken on the running of the accommodation at the Hurtwood Hideout, which was formally a youth hostel owned and run by the YHA. The operation supplies hostel type accommodation and camping, as well as catering for the groups staying. This business has led to further jobs for local people and increases business in the local area.
